Fearless Leadership - The Origin Story
In this Fearless Schools podcast episode, we talk to Dr. Doug Reeves about fearless leadership in education, emphasizing the importance of creating psychologically safe environments where teachers and leaders can challenge each other for better student outcomes. The conversation explores the origins of the Fearless Leadership book from CLS, which explores many critical school leadership topics, such as practical strategies for fostering trust, and the role of resilience in educational leadership. Key topics Fearless leadership definition and importance Creating psychologically safe school environments Strategies for new leaders to build trust The role of resilience in educational leadership Addressing toxic school cultures Time management and focus in school leadership
